James Kass wrote: > Foster Feng wrote: > > Does anyone know if there is a convertor that can > > convert UTF-8 to Shift-JIS? > > Try uniconv.exe by Basis Technology. > > It is distributed for free as a demo of the Rosette > library; download from > http://rosette.basistech.com/demo.html > > It's a big file, but does many formats including UTF-8 > to Shift-JIS, IIRC. > While we're listing them, don't forget C-Kermit: http://www.columbia.edu/kermit/ckermit.html At the C-Kermit> prompt, simply type: translate <inputfilename> utf8 shift-jis <outputfilename> Of course C-Kermit is more than just an iconv or recode replacement, since it can also perform this and many other character-set conversions as part of the file transfer process using Kermit protocol on serial or network connections, and in version 8.0: http://www.columbia.edu/kermit/ck80.html also in FTP. - Frank
